What is the Sensapex uMc-CLN Pipette Cleaning System?
The Sensapex uMc-CLN is a precision automated pressure controller designed specifically to clean glass patch pipettes between recordings, enabling the same pipette to be reused for up to 100 sequential cell patches without manual replacement. By automating the pipette cleaning cycle — using proven Alconox or Tergazyme cleaning protocols validated in multiple peer-reviewed studies — the uMc-CLN dramatically increases throughput in electrophysiology workflows and reduces per-experiment consumable costs.
The system integrates seamlessly with Sensapex micromanipulators and the uMp-TSC touch screen controller, providing a 1-click cleaning interface that fits naturally into established patch clamp workflows. Available in 2-, 4-, and 8-channel desktop configurations, the uMc-CLN supports both solo patch and multi-electrode recording setups.

Technical Specifications
| Catalog Number | uMc-CLN (2, 4, or 8-channel versions) |
| Pressure Range | ±70 kPa |
| Pressure Resolution | 7 Pa |
| Accuracy | ±140 Pa (absolute, closed-loop) |
| Channels | 2, 4, or 8 (desktop versions) |
| Pressure Supply (2/4-ch) | 80 kPa vacuum + 150 kPa from lab facility |
| Pressure Supply (8-ch) | Minimum +400 kPa (pre-regulation unit required) |
| Control Interface | uMp-TSC2 touch screen or uMx software |
| Cleaning Agents | Alconox, Tergazyme (peer-reviewed validated) |
| License | GTRC and MIT, USA |
